Introduction to ANTHE and Its Importance
The ANTHE (Aakash National Talent Hunt Exam) is a gateway for students aspiring to excel in the fields of engineering and medicine. It assesses proficiency in subjects like Mathematics, Physics, Chemistry, and Biology, with a strong emphasis on numerical problem-solving.
Why Numerical Problems Matter in ANTHE
Numerical problems form the backbone of the ANTHE, testing not just knowledge but also analytical and problem-solving skills. Excelling in this section can significantly boost your overall score and ranking.

Resources for ANTHE Numerical Problem Practice
Choosing the right study materials is crucial for effective preparation. Here are some recommended resources to help you master numerical problems for ANTHE.
Recommended Books and Guides
Books like ‘Objective Mathematics by R.D. Sharma’ and ‘Concepts of Physics by H.C. Verma’ are excellent resources for in-depth understanding and practice.
Online Platforms and Mock Tests
Websites like BYJU’s, Khan Academy, and Aakash’s own online portal offer extensive practice questions and mock tests tailored for ANTHE preparation.
